comunicações digitais contam com várias técnicas de verificação de erros para garantir que os dados são transmitidos de forma precisa um lugar para outro . O bit de paridade , que é uma das formas mais simples de detecção de erro , é bastante conhecida , porque é usado em comunicações de porta serial do computador padrão . Com paridade ímpar , o bit de paridade é definido de modo que o número total de uns em dados transmitidos ( incluindo o bit de paridade ) é um número ímpar . Instruções
1
Anote a forma binária dos dados que você deseja calcular a paridade para . Os números binários permitir todas as informações a ser representado por uma seqüência de uns e zeros . Existem inúmeros sites e programas freeware que pode converter os dados para o formato binário. Se os dados estiverem em forma de personagem, converter de " ASCII" para binário . Se os dados estiverem em forma numérica , converter de " decimal " para binário.
2
Contagem o número de uns na sua seqüência de uns e zeros .
3
Divida esse número por dois. Se o resultado desta divisão é um número inteiro ( o que significa que não tem fração) , você tem um número par de uns. Se o resultado da divisão não é um número inteiro , você tem um número ímpar de queridos. Por exemplo, 7/2 = 3,5, então 7 é um número ímpar ; . 12/2 = 6 , então 12 é um número par
4
Definir o bit de paridade para 1 se você tem um mesmo número de uns , ou configurá-lo para zero, se você tem um número ímpar de queridos. Desta forma , o bit de paridade , mais o número de uns for um número ímpar , o que é a exigência de paridade ímpar . Se você tem 7 queridos, o bit de paridade deve ser zero , pois 7 já é um número ímpar . Se você tem 12 queridos, o bit de paridade deve ser 1, porque 12 mais 1 faz 13 anos, e 13 é um número ímpar.